GPU.ai lists 6 GPU models across 6 configurations, starting at $0.340 per GPU-hour for the RTX 4090. It is the cheapest dedicated provider we track for 2 of its 6 GPU-and-pricing-model combinations: RTX 4090 (on-demand), B200 (on-demand).
| GPU | VRAM | Pricing | GPU.ai $/GPU-hr | Best dedicated | Difference | Cheapest at |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| RTX 4090 | 24 GB | on-demand | $0.340 | $0.340 | cheapest | — | rent |
| L40S | 48 GB | on-demand | $0.610 | $0.550 | +11% | Novita | rent |
| A100 SXM | 80 GB | on-demand | $1.12 | $1.09 | +3% | Thunder Compute | rent |
| H100 SXM | 80 GB | on-demand | $1.87 | $1.79 | +4% | Cudo Compute | rent |
| H200 | 141 GB | on-demand | $3.59 | $3.03 | +19% | Seeweb | rent |
| B200 | 192 GB | on-demand | $4.90 | $4.90 | cheapest | — | rent |
